Front
What is conduction?
Back
Conduction is the transfer of heat through direct contact of molecules or particles with each other.

Front
What is convection?
Back
Convection is the transfer of heat through the movement of fluids (liquids or gases) caused by differences in temperature and density.

Front
What is radiation?
Back
Radiation is the transfer of heat in the form of electromagnetic waves, which can travel through space.
